HKBU High Table Dinner
Introduction
With the generous donation from Tin Ka Ping Foundation, the Office of Student Affairs is launching a series of High Table Dinners aimed at instilling and inspiring students with a multi-dimensional experience in developing perspectives in a formal dining atmosphere.
Students will be provided invaluable opportunity to meet about 40 potential employers including leaders from commercial organisations and the community. Prestigious speakers will share valuable experiences regarding societal and career experiences, life insights and ambitions.
With the precious opportunity to communicate with employers and experience in solemn events, students may broaden their insight and develop their perspectives contributing to their growth, career and life planning.

Activating Your Miracle: Navigating Global Entertainment Challenges in the Digital Era
Keynote Speaker: Mr. Ken Lai, CEO of Brandoville Studios, Brandoville Academy and Brandoville Hong Kong
Ken Lai is a visionary entrepreneur and CEO of Brandoville Studios, Brandoville Academy, and Brandoville Hong Kong. With over two decades of experience, he has led Brandoville Studios to become a premier Computer Graphics Art studio in Indonesia, known for top-tier Triple-A Games and High-Profile Animations. As the founder of Brandoville Academy, he established it as the First Unreal Engine Authorized Training Center in Southeast Asia, empowering the next generation in computer graphics, game development, art technology, and AI.
